What you can expect as an NDT Technician at DAS Aviation:

This position requires the willingness to successfully learn and implement the job skills and technology associated with Non-Destructive Testing. Technician level is determined by experience, training and certifications achieved per NAS 410. The job requires the technician be willing to work the days and hours necessary to complete any given task. Working nights and weekends may be required frequently. A willingness to work safely around x-radiation is required. A basic knowledge of aircraft and specifically aircraft structures is desired. Job duties will vary each day and will be designated by the NDT Supervisor or their designee.

Working Conditions
  • Work is performed in a NDT lab or hangar environment which can be subject to extreme temperature variations.
  • Varied positions in and around the aircraft.
  • Work around X-radiation will be required.
Equipment Used
  • Personal hand tools supplied by the mechanic.
  • NDT equipment including ultraviolet lights, high amperage magnetic particle inspection machines, x-ray machines, x-ray film processor, eddy current tester, ultrasonic flaw detector and other equipment as required.

Company Description

With over 78 years of industry experience, West Star Aviation stands as a leading independent Maintenance, Repair and Overhaul (MRO) provider. Employing over 3,000 professionals, we offer comprehensive services from our strategically located full-service facilities in East Alton, IL; Grand Junction, CO; Chattanooga, TN; Millville, NJ; Perryville, Missouri; and Statesville, NC as well as satellite locations in Denver, Houston, Minneapolis and Chicago. Our extensive capabilities encompass maintenance, paint, interior, and avionics services, supported by the largest Aircraft On Ground (AOG) network in the country, ensuring prompt and reliable mobile repair services nationwide.
